Embracing the empty nest: A new chapter of growth and opportunity

Sep 26 2023
empty nest syndrome the-birds-nest-

My 17 year old son is applying to universities and I am wondering how my life will look like once he’ll leave the nest. Waving a child off to university is a bittersweet moment for parents. The sense of pride in seeing them embark on this new adventure is often tinged with a profound feeling of loss. Empty nest syndrome, though not classified as an official mental health issue, is a real and valid experience for many parents. According to a survey by Unite Students, 98% of parents reported feeling ‘extreme grief’ after their first child left for university. It’s essential to acknowledge and navigate these emotions, but also to recognise the incredible opportunities this new chapter presents.
